sheson Posted September 17, 2021 Author Posted September 17, 2021 1 hour ago, Dreifels said: confusing ingame message v. 2.9.6 "DynDoLod cannot read file DynDoLod_none" ingame left up text line in window when I load save being in Vigilant/Coldharbour can't find error log, FAQ: Game: DynDOLOD could not read DynDOLOD_Worlds / DynDOLOD can not read data for [worldspace name] from DynDOLOD_Worlds / DynDOLOD_Worlds does not belong to these DynDOLOD plugins / DynDOLOD can not read bunchofnumbers from DynDOLOD_[worldspace name] / DynDOLOD_[worldspace name] does not belong to these DynDOLOD plugins / DynDOLOD can not read index data from DynDOLOD_[worlspace name] / DynDOLOD can not find [worldspace name] in DynDOLOD_Worlds / DynDOLOD can not find master data in DynDOLOD_[worldspace name] A: Make sure SKSE and DynDOLOD DLL or PapyrusUtil are installed correctly, see DynDOLOD requires DynDOLOD.DLL/PapyrusUtil above. A: Make sure the *.[json|txt] data files in the SKSE subfolder of the DynDOLOD output and the DynDOLOD plugins are in sync from the same generation process. Check the DynDOLOD SkyUI MCM Information page in the game that all plugins and files have the same bunch of numbers. A: Make sure the *.[json|txt] data files in the SKSE subfolder of the DynDOLOD output are in the load order and can be read. In case DynDOLOD DLL is used, check the c:\Users\[username]\Documents\My Games\[Skyrim|Skyrim Special Edition|Skyrim VR]\SKSE\DynDOLOD.log for errors. The DynDOLOD generation log is saved to the ..\DynDOLOD\logs folder.

I would like to do that if possible. Otherwise, what would be the reason no billboards are generated? This is the DynDOLOD 2.x thread. Its TexGen version does not generate billboards. Billboards are required to generate tree LOD. They are also required for ultra tree LOD, e.g. LOD for trees done in object LOD. Use DynDOLOD 3 Alpha. Its TexGen version generates billboards for the current load order.
